We have to find the slope having points (-1,1) and (1,-1), We are going to use the formula for the slope of the line

[tex]m=\frac{y2-y1}{x2-x1}=\frac{-1-1}{1-(-1)}=\frac{-2}{2}=-1[/tex]

The answer is m= -1
